Roll call vote: 5-0, all Ayes CEF Gift - Mrs. Cindy Matheison of the Cohasset Education Foundation (CEF) addressed the Committee. She reviewed three grants the CEF would be funding: $15,085 to fund Building a Positive Learning Environment; $14,945 to fund Teaching Metacognition through Documentary Making in the Classroom; and $4,600 to fund Language Immersion Professional Development, for total of$34,630. Mrs.Astino moved to accept the grants totaling$34,630. Mrs. McGoldrick seconded the motion and the vote was unanimous. Roll call vote: 4-0-1. Katie Dugan abstained from the vote. U.S. News and World Report Massachusetts High School Rankings—Superintendent Cataldo reviewed the report for the Committee. Cohasset went from 13 to 31, but it has to do with the metrics the companies use to compile the lists. Hingham and other communities' rankings changed as well. The rankings in U.S. News and World Report allow AP Testing scores to be factored in. Chairman Ognibene 3 School Committee—5/20/15 -JBO stated that they would like to create their own internal report card where they would determine their own peers and metrics. There was then an extensive discussion regarding Cohasset testing scores and a review of the acceptance/College attendance statistics in Cohasset for 2012—2014. Mrs. Dugan then reviewed statistics she compiled from the U.S. News and World Report. It is her overall observation that the rankings are heavily weighted toward college readiness. The Committee then discussed looking at testing and comparing the grades in the AP classes during the year and then compare those to the results of the final AP exam. Mrs. Dugan added that when the Committee does discuss the internal report card,they should consider putting a Charter School amongst the peers. Superintendent Cataldo stated that she did not want the Committee to put much credence into the fact that the ranking keeps changing; in the end,the magazine could end up changing how much emphasis they put on the AP testing. World Language—High School Superintendent Cataldo explained that the only 6 students have signed up for Latin and it is not fiscally responsible to run the class with a half-time teacher. They can instead offer these students an online Latin class. Mrs. Astino said that languages are tough in Cohasset because of block scheduling. Mrs. McGoldrick said it would be interesting to look at other districts and see what they do with language. Flood Update Superintendent Cataldo updated the Committee on the status of the office.
